Rapamycin Uses and Potential Benefits

Rapamycin was originally developed to prevent organ transplant rejection by suppressing the immune system.

Recently, it has gained attention for its potential role in slowing aging. Research suggests it may influence longevity by inhibiting the mTOR pathway, which regulates cell growth and metabolism. Scientists are also exploring its possible benefits in age-related conditions and diseases.

FDA-Approved Uses of Rapamycin

Rapamycin is currently approved for:

  • Preventing organ transplant rejection (such as kidney transplants)
  • Treating lymphangioleiomyomatosis (LAM), a rare lung disease affecting women

Potential Benefits Being Studied

While not FDA-approved for these purposes, ongoing research suggests Rapamycin may offer benefits in:

  • Longevity & Anti-Aging: May slow age-related decline by promoting cellular repair
  • Cognitive Health: Being studied for its potential to reduce the risk of Alzheimer’s and Parkinson’s
  • Immune System Support: Could enhance immune function in older adults
  • Cancer Research: Shows promise in slowing tumor growth
  • Metabolic Health: May improve insulin sensitivity and support weight management

Although Rapamycin is being explored for aging and metabolic benefits, these uses remain off-label and require further research. Always consult a healthcare professional before considering its use.

What is Rapamycin?

Autophagy

Autophagy is the body’s natural process of clearing out damaged cells and replacing them with healthy ones. This built-in recycling system helps maintain cellular function and overall health by eliminating waste and dysfunctional components.

Immunosuppressive Effects

Rapamycin helps regulate the immune system by reducing excessive activity. Originally used to prevent organ rejection in transplant patients, it also plays a role in lowering chronic inflammation, which is linked to many age-related diseases. This effect may contribute to a healthier and more balanced immune response over time.

Cognitive Function

Rapamycin is being studied for its potential to support brain health and cognitive function. By influencing the mTOR pathway and reducing inflammation, it may help protect brain cells from age-related decline, potentially lowering the risk of neurodegenerative diseases like Alzheimer’s.

mTOR Pathway

The mTOR pathway controls cell growth and metabolism, playing a key role in aging and overall health. Rapamycin inhibits this pathway, which may contribute to increased lifespan and improved cellular function by slowing down age-related processes.

Anti-Inflammatory

Rapamycin helps control inflammation by modulating the immune response, which may lower the risk of chronic diseases. Since inflammation increases with age, contributing to conditions like heart disease, diabetes, dementia, and cancer, Rapamycin’s anti-inflammatory effects could support healthier aging and overall well-being.

Cardiovascular Health Effects

Rapamycin may support heart health by improving how heart cells handle stress and slowing the progression of atherosclerosis (hardening of the arteries). By promoting cellular resilience, it could help maintain cardiovascular function and reduce age-related risks.

Rapamycin Mechanism of Action

Rapamycin is an innovative rejuvenation medication that targets biological pathways associated with aging.

It works by inhibiting a protein called mTOR, which plays a key role in cell growth and aging. This inhibition helps slow down processes that contribute to cellular aging.

Side Effects of Rapamycin

Rapamycin is being studied for its potential role in longevity and healthspan extension. While it offers promising benefits, some individuals may experience mild to moderate side effects.

These effects often depend on dosage, individual health conditions, and how the body responds to mTOR pathway inhibition. Regular monitoring and medical guidance can help manage any changes effectively.

Common Effects

  • Energy Levels: Some individuals may experience changes in energy due to mTOR pathway inhibition.
  • Digestive Response: Mild gastrointestinal discomfort, such as nausea or abdominal sensitivity, can often be managed with dosage adjustments or dietary modifications.
  • Headaches: Occasionally reported, but staying hydrated and getting adequate rest may help alleviate symptoms.

Additional Considerations

  • Immune Response: Some individuals may experience temporary changes, such as mild respiratory or urinary tract discomfort.
  • Oral Health: Minor gum sensitivity or mouth sores have been reported in certain cases.
  • Lipid Levels: A study observed a moderate rise in triglycerides, making regular cholesterol and lipid monitoring advisable.
  • Kidney Health: Monitoring kidney function is recommended, especially for individuals with preexisting conditions.
